1// SPDX-License-Identifier: GPL-2.0-or-later 2/* 3 * Copyright 2014 IBM Corp. 4 */ 5 6#include <linux/debugfs.h> 7#include <linux/kernel.h> 8#include <linux/slab.h> 9 10#include "cxl.h" 11 12static struct dentry *cxl_debugfs; 13 14/* Helpers to export CXL mmaped IO registers via debugfs */ 15static int debugfs_io_u64_get(void *data, u64 *val) 16{ 17 *val = in_be64((u64 __iomem *)data); 18 return 0; 19} 20 21static int debugfs_io_u64_set(void *data, u64 val) 22{ 23 out_be64((u64 __iomem *)data, val); 24 return 0; 25} 26DEFINE_DEBUGFS_ATTRIBUTE(fops_io_x64, debugfs_io_u64_get, debugfs_io_u64_set, 27 "0x%016llx\n"); 28 29static struct dentry *debugfs_create_io_x64(const char *name, umode_t mode, 30 struct dentry *parent, u64 __iomem *value) 31{ 32 return debugfs_create_file_unsafe(name, mode, parent, 33 (void __force *)value, &fops_io_x64); 34} 35 36void cxl_debugfs_add_adapter_regs_psl9(struct cxl *adapter, struct dentry *dir) 37{ 38 debugfs_create_io_x64("fir1", S_IRUSR, dir, _cxl_p1_addr(adapter, CXL_PSL9_FIR1)); 39 debugfs_create_io_x64("fir_mask", 0400, dir, 40 _cxl_p1_addr(adapter, CXL_PSL9_FIR_MASK)); 41 debugfs_create_io_x64("fir_cntl", S_IRUSR, dir, _cxl_p1_addr(adapter, CXL_PSL9_FIR_CNTL)); 42 debugfs_create_io_x64("trace", S_IRUSR | S_IWUSR, dir, _cxl_p1_addr(adapter, CXL_PSL9_TRACECFG)); 43 debugfs_create_io_x64("debug", 0600, dir, 44 _cxl_p1_addr(adapter, CXL_PSL9_DEBUG)); 45 debugfs_create_io_x64("xsl-debug", 0600, dir, 46 _cxl_p1_addr(adapter, CXL_XSL9_DBG)); 47} 48 49void cxl_debugfs_add_adapter_regs_psl8(struct cxl *adapter, struct dentry *dir) 50{ 51 debugfs_create_io_x64("fir1", S_IRUSR, dir, _cxl_p1_addr(adapter, CXL_PSL_FIR1)); 52 debugfs_create_io_x64("fir2", S_IRUSR, dir, _cxl_p1_addr(adapter, CXL_PSL_FIR2)); 53 debugfs_create_io_x64("fir_cntl", S_IRUSR, dir, _cxl_p1_addr(adapter, CXL_PSL_FIR_CNTL)); 54 debugfs_create_io_x64("trace", S_IRUSR | S_IWUSR, dir, _cxl_p1_addr(adapter, CXL_PSL_TRACE)); 55} 56 57int cxl_debugfs_adapter_add(struct cxl *adapter) 58{ 59 struct dentry *dir; 60 char buf[32]; 61 62 if (!cxl_debugfs) 63 return -ENODEV; 64 65 snprintf(buf, 32, "card%i", adapter->adapter_num); 66 dir = debugfs_create_dir(buf, cxl_debugfs); 67 if (IS_ERR(dir)) 68 return PTR_ERR(dir); 69 adapter->debugfs = dir; 70 71 debugfs_create_io_x64("err_ivte", S_IRUSR, dir, _cxl_p1_addr(adapter, CXL_PSL_ErrIVTE)); 72 73 if (adapter->native->sl_ops->debugfs_add_adapter_regs) 74 adapter->native->sl_ops->debugfs_add_adapter_regs(adapter, dir); 75 return 0; 76} 77 78void cxl_debugfs_adapter_remove(struct cxl *adapter) 79{ 80 debugfs_remove_recursive(adapter->debugfs); 81} 82 83void cxl_debugfs_add_afu_regs_psl9(struct cxl_afu *afu, struct dentry *dir) 84{ 85 debugfs_create_io_x64("serr", S_IRUSR, dir, _cxl_p1n_addr(afu, CXL_PSL_SERR_An)); 86} 87 88void cxl_debugfs_add_afu_regs_psl8(struct cxl_afu *afu, struct dentry *dir) 89{ 90 debugfs_create_io_x64("sstp0", S_IRUSR, dir, _cxl_p2n_addr(afu, CXL_SSTP0_An)); 91 debugfs_create_io_x64("sstp1", S_IRUSR, dir, _cxl_p2n_addr(afu, CXL_SSTP1_An)); 92 93 debugfs_create_io_x64("fir", S_IRUSR, dir, _cxl_p1n_addr(afu, CXL_PSL_FIR_SLICE_An)); 94 debugfs_create_io_x64("serr", S_IRUSR, dir, _cxl_p1n_addr(afu, CXL_PSL_SERR_An)); 95 debugfs_create_io_x64("afu_debug", S_IRUSR, dir, _cxl_p1n_addr(afu, CXL_AFU_DEBUG_An)); 96 debugfs_create_io_x64("trace", S_IRUSR | S_IWUSR, dir, _cxl_p1n_addr(afu, CXL_PSL_SLICE_TRACE)); 97} 98 99int cxl_debugfs_afu_add(struct cxl_afu *afu) 100{ 101 struct dentry *dir; 102 char buf[32]; 103 104 if (!afu->adapter->debugfs) 105 return -ENODEV; 106 107 snprintf(buf, 32, "psl%i.%i", afu->adapter->adapter_num, afu->slice); 108 dir = debugfs_create_dir(buf, afu->adapter->debugfs); 109 if (IS_ERR(dir)) 110 return PTR_ERR(dir); 111 afu->debugfs = dir; 112 113 debugfs_create_io_x64("sr", S_IRUSR, dir, _cxl_p1n_addr(afu, CXL_PSL_SR_An)); 114 debugfs_create_io_x64("dsisr", S_IRUSR, dir, _cxl_p2n_addr(afu, CXL_PSL_DSISR_An)); 115 debugfs_create_io_x64("dar", S_IRUSR, dir, _cxl_p2n_addr(afu, CXL_PSL_DAR_An)); 116 117 debugfs_create_io_x64("err_status", S_IRUSR, dir, _cxl_p2n_addr(afu, CXL_PSL_ErrStat_An)); 118 119 if (afu->adapter->native->sl_ops->debugfs_add_afu_regs) 120 afu->adapter->native->sl_ops->debugfs_add_afu_regs(afu, dir); 121 122 return 0; 123} 124 125void cxl_debugfs_afu_remove(struct cxl_afu *afu) 126{ 127 debugfs_remove_recursive(afu->debugfs); 128} 129 130int __init cxl_debugfs_init(void) 131{ 132 struct dentry *ent; 133 134 if (!cpu_has_feature(CPU_FTR_HVMODE)) 135 return 0; 136 137 ent = debugfs_create_dir("cxl", NULL); 138 if (IS_ERR(ent)) 139 return PTR_ERR(ent); 140 cxl_debugfs = ent; 141 142 return 0; 143} 144 145void cxl_debugfs_exit(void) 146{ 147 debugfs_remove_recursive(cxl_debugfs); 148}
